Output 266ac6fe64e24d86b161b6e66bff34afdec5f78a500911f2ff05b5f9629dd60a:0

value
18971236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ba4a26f7bdfbe6425fee289970237d22f24115 OP_EQUAL
address
3FRzSx66vX36gHgn8SwLuXqHuuwQVbBAaE
transaction
266ac6fe64e24d86b161b6e66bff34afdec5f78a500911f2ff05b5f9629dd60a
spent
true